About This Recruitment
Staff Selection Commission (SSC) has officially released the SSC Combined Graduate Level Examination (CGL) 2026 notification for approximately 12256 Group B and Group C vacancies in various Ministries, Departments, Constitutional Bodies, Tribunals and Government Offices under the Government of India. SSC CGL is one of the largest graduate-level government recruitment examinations in India and offers highly prestigious central government posts such as Assistant Section Officer (ASO), Income Tax Inspector, Central Excise Inspector, Preventive Officer, Examiner, Assistant Enforcement Officer, Auditor, Accountant, Tax Assistant, Junior Statistical Officer (JSO), Statistical Investigator Grade-II and several other administrative, finance and investigative positions. As per the official SSC CGL 2026 notification, the online application process has started from 21 May 2026 and eligible candidates can apply online till 22 June 2026 up to 11:00 PM through the official SSC website. The last date for online fee payment is 23 June 2026 up to 11:00 PM while the application correction window will remain active from 29 June 2026 to 01 July 2026. SSC CGL Tier-I Computer Based Examination is tentatively scheduled between August and September 2026 while Tier-II Examination is expected in December 2026. Candidates selected through SSC CGL Recruitment 2026 will receive salary under Pay Level-4 to Pay Level-8 with starting monthly salary approximately ranging from Rs. 25,500 to Rs. 81,100 depending upon the post and city category. Additional benefits include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), Transport Allowance, Pension Benefits, Medical Facilities, Government Accommodation and departmental promotion opportunities. SSC CGL remains one of the most searched and competitive examinations among graduate aspirants because it provides stable central government service, officer-level positions, nationwide postings and excellent long-term career growth. The selection process includes Tier-I Computer Based Examination, Tier-II Examination, Data Entry Speed Test (DEST), Computer Knowledge Test and document verification depending on the post applied for. Tier-I examination consists of General Intelligence & Reasoning, General Awareness, Quantitative Aptitude and English Comprehension with negative marking applicable for incorrect answers. - What is the qualification required for SSC CGL Recruitment 2026 Apply Online – Combined Graduate Level Examination for 12256 Group B & Group C Posts?
- Candidates must have Candidates must possess Bachelor Degree in any stream from a recognized university in India. For Junior Statistical Officer (JSO), candidates must have minimum 60% marks in Mathematics at 12th level OR Bachelor Degree with Statistics as a subject. For Statistical Investigator Grade-II, Statistics must be one of the subjects in Graduation. Assistant Audit Officer and Assistant Accounts Officer posts may require desirable qualifications such as CA, CMA, CS, MBA Finance, M.Com or Economics as mentioned in the official notification. to be eligible for this recruitment.
- What is the age limit for this job?
- Minimum Age: 18 Years | Maximum Age: 27-32 Years Post Wise | Age Relaxation Extra as per SSC CGL 2026 Recruitment Rules
